Texto completoThe problem this research study aims to address is the development of architectural values in graduate architecture students and faculty. This study explores the relationship between academic values (architectural concepts) and practical skillsets (architectural competencies) within architectural education. It also investigates the relationship between student and faculty value priorities in regards to the profession. Conducted at the University of Virginia, School of Architecture, the study utilized the administration of the researcher-made Architectural Values Inventory (AVI), based on Rokeach's (1973) Value Survey. The principal component analysis, used to evaluate reliability and validity proved, the AVI to be both valid and reliable surfacing six significant components. The canonical correlation analysis showed a significant relationship between architectural concepts and competencies. The Goodman-Kruskal gamma rendered a relationship between students and faculty on only five of the 32 architectural values, subsequently showing little to no correlation between students and faculty on the whole. These research findings have the potential to influence areas of architectural education such as accreditation, curriculum development, professional development, and professional practice.

Texto completoInspired by the implementation of the Common Core State Standards, which contains skills related to technology and media use for students in kindergarten to grade 12, and the International Society of Technology Education Technology Standards for Administrators the researcher chose to focus this dissertation is on principal technology leadership competencies that elementary principals will need to lead technology integration for teaching and learning in their respective schools. The researcher examined a range of sources, including research from internet-based sources and traditional (hard-copy) journals. The Principals’ Technology Leadership Assessment (PTLA) survey was used to assess principals’ technology leadership competencies of 132 principals from one school district in the District of Columbia metropolitan area. Using the PTLA survey response data, quantitative data analyses, including linear regression analyses, an analysis of variance, a t-test, and distribution frequency analyses, were conducted and used to determine how the independent variables, shared leadership style, transformational leadership style, support disposition, encouragement disposition, gender, and the socioeconomic status of the schools served by these principals, individually affect the dependent variable, principals’ technology leadership competencies for the ideal purpose of making predictions that may have an impact on future planning, monitoring, or evaluation of a process or practice within the K-12 educational system. Findings provide evidence that the transformational leadership style serve as a powerful predictor of technology leadership competencies for elementary principals. Texto completoThe main aim of this masters dissertation, entitled Development of Competencies at Technical High Schools, is to identify whether the competencies of students from state-run technical high schools meet the demands of the labor market, as set forth in the guidelines published by the Brazilian Ministry of Education, taking into consideration the perspectives of the state-run public schools (education agents) and the labor market (employment agents). The study also seeks to contribute to the Prioridade Rio [Priority Rio] program, which promotes the study of priority areas for the Rio de Janeiro state government, with the support of Fundação de Amparo à Pesquisa do Estado do Rio de Janeiro [Rio de Janeiro State Research Funding Agency] (FAPERJ), so as to better align the education provided with market needs. The methodology adopted for this study involved qualitative research of an exploratory nature. This included research of the literature and other documents, telematic research and field study. The most important source of data was the transcriptions of interviews, in which the interviewees expressed their viewpoints and perceptions about the development of competencies by students at technical high schools. A total of 27 people were interviewed, of whom five were from Fundação de Apoio à Escola Técnica [Technical School Support Foundation] (FAETEC), three came from the two companies representing the labor market, and twenty were from state-run technical high schools from different cities in Rio de Janeiro state: Escola Técnica Henrique Lage (Niterói), Escola Técnica Ferreira Viana (Rio de Janeiro) and Escola Técnica João Luiz do Nascimento (Nova Iguaçu). In the analysis of the interviews and discussion of the results, the interview contents were divided into five categories: The relationship between Technical high school and labor market, Conception of Technical Competencies, Technical Training, the Role of Technical Education, and Construction of a Competency-Based Curriculum. As a result, several helpful and hindering factors were identified, based on which the development of the competencies of students from technical high schools can be aligned to meet the demands of the labor market.

Texto completoPara competir com sucesso no atual contexto de mercado, caracterizado pela existência de clientes exigentes, heterogéneos e nem sempre de fácil compreensão, as organizações produtivas estão a desenvolver cada vez mais a sua capacidade de mass customization (MCC), definida como a capacidade de satisfazer a exigência idiossincrática de cada cliente sem compromissos significativos em termos de custo, tempo de entrega e qualidade. A literatura tem vindo a negligenciar o papel das competências individuais (IC) no desenvolvimento da MCC, mesmo se as empresas atualmente estão a ter maior atenção à oportunidade de desenvolver a competência dos próprios colaboradores. O presente estudo teve como objetivo reduzir essa lacuna, utilizando um método de avaliação das IC bem consolidado - a behavioral event interview - e, desse modo, investigar como as IC de um operations manager (OM), sendo esse um dos papéis profissionais mais influenciados pela personalização de produto, melhora a MCC da empresa. Para tanto, foi projetado um multiple-case study em oito empresas industriais, escolhidas com base na lógica da réplica literal e teórica entre fabricantes de máquinas de um país europeu. A partir dessa amostra recolhemos dados de vários níveis da MCC de cada organização e das IC do seu OM. Com o estudo emergiram cinco IC dos OMs - negotiation, information seeking, efficiency orientation, analytical/systems thinking, e pattern recognition - e o trabalho fornece evidências empíricas e explicações lógicas dos efeitos positivos dessas IC na MCC da empresa. A presente tese é a primeira pesquisa sobre competências de gestão que facilitam a MCC e baseia-se em dados de vários níveis da MCC de uma organização e nas IC do seu OM e não sobre as suas experiências e opiniões. O estudo apresenta também indicações para práticas de gestão ao nível dos recursos humanos em empresas que procuram uma estratégia de mass customization. Este estudo apresenta a possibilidade de ser replicado noutros papéis profissionais, setores produtivos e até países.
